    Cut myself shaving? Well, something like that. I have a neighbor who has one of those black floating dock things that you can drive your boat up on. I got this stupid hair brained idea that I could drive my airplane up on it. WRONG. I came up to it at idle but it was too high and caught the bow eye and punched it back into the hull leaving a nice little hole. Some aircraft (duct) tape covered the hole and got here airworthy again. I will fix it in the not too distant future, but you know, when I have time, I would rather fly than fix the bow eye.<br /><br />The worst part is that I can not hang my hamock.
